Global Automobile Mufflers Market to Reach US$13.5 Billion by 2030

The global market for Automobile Mufflers estimated at US$10.6 Billion in the year 2024, is expected to reach US$13.5 Billion by 2030, growing at a CAGR of 4.1% over the analysis period 2024-2030. Absorptive Mufflers, one of the segments analyzed in the report, is expected to record a 3.4% CAGR and reach US$8.8 Billion by the end of the analysis period. Growth in the Reactive Mufflers segment is estimated at 5.6% CAGR over the analysis period.

The U.S. Market is Estimated at US$2.9 Billion While China is Forecast to Grow at 7.5% CAGR

The Automobile Mufflers market in the U.S. is estimated at US$2.9 Billion in the year 2024. China, the world's second largest economy, is forecast to reach a projected market size of US$2.7 Billion by the year 2030 trailing a CAGR of 7.5% over the analysis period 2024-2030. Among the other noteworthy geographic markets are Japan and Canada, each forecast to grow at a CAGR of 1.7% and 3.2% respectively over the analysis period. Within Europe, Germany is forecast to grow at approximately 2.4% CAGR.

Global Automobile Mufflers Market - Key Trends & Drivers Summarized

Why Are Automobile Mufflers Still Vital in the Age of Modern Mobility?

Despite the rise of advanced automotive technologies and the gradual shift toward electrification, automobile mufflers continue to play a critical role in internal combustion engine (ICE) vehicles, which still dominate global roads. These components are not merely about silencing engine noise; they also contribute significantly to emissions control, vehicle performance, and compliance with increasingly stringent environmental regulations. In ICE vehicles, mufflers are integrated with exhaust systems to reduce acoustic pollution and optimize backpressure, directly impacting fuel efficiency and engine longevity. As urbanization grows and cities enforce tighter noise ordinances, the need for more efficient and quieter muffling solutions is becoming a regulatory and consumer imperative. Even in hybrid vehicles, where ICEs are intermittently engaged, high-performance mufflers remain essential. Thus, while the automotive world leans toward EVs, the transitional period demands innovation and continued relevance in muffler design, materials, and manufacturing.

What Are the Latest Technological Advancements in Muffler Design?

Modern muffler systems are evolving far beyond simple noise dampeners. Advanced materials such as stainless steel alloys, titanium, and ceramics are now being used to withstand higher operating temperatures, resist corrosion, and reduce weight-especially crucial in high-performance and fuel-efficient vehicles. Active noise control technologies are being introduced, allowing electronic manipulation of sound waves for optimal cabin quietness and external noise suppression. Integration with catalytic converters and diesel particulate filters is becoming common, creating multi-functional exhaust systems that reduce emissions and comply with Euro 6/7 and EPA Tier standards. Additionally, 3D printing and computer-aided design (CAD) tools are being leveraged to create complex internal chamber geometries, enhancing sound attenuation while maintaining minimal backpressure. Modular muffler components are also gaining popularity, allowing easier replacements and customization. These innovations ensure that mufflers remain compliant with evolving emissions and noise standards without sacrificing performance or fuel economy.

How Are Market Dynamics and End-Use Trends Shaping Demand for Mufflers?

Global vehicle production trends and end-use patterns are significantly influencing the automobile mufflers market. Emerging economies in Asia-Pacific, Latin America, and parts of Africa are witnessing rising demand for two-wheelers, passenger cars, and light commercial vehicles powered by ICEs, thus sustaining muffler demand. Moreover, consumer preference for sports utility vehicles (SUVs) and performance cars-which often require dual or customized exhaust systems-is driving the growth of premium muffler segments. The aftermarket is also robust, driven by vehicle owners seeking enhanced sound, aesthetic modifications, or replacements due to wear and tear. Government inspections and roadworthiness regulations in regions such as Europe and Japan compel timely muffler replacements, further fueling demand. Fleet operators and logistics providers emphasize fuel efficiency and noise compliance, spurring OEMs to integrate advanced mufflers during manufacturing. While EV adoption is rising, the global vehicle fleet turnover rate ensures that ICE-powered vehicles-and their associated components-will remain relevant well into the next decade.

What Key Forces Are Propelling Market Growth Across Regions?

The growth in the automobile mufflers market is driven by several factors. First, the global dominance of ICE-powered vehicles, especially in developing countries, continues to sustain core demand. Second, increasingly stringent environmental and noise pollution regulations are compelling automakers to incorporate advanced muffling technologies to ensure regulatory compliance. Third, consumer demand for quieter, smoother rides is pushing both OEMs and aftermarket suppliers to invest in performance-optimized muffler designs. Fourth, the rising popularity of performance vehicles and customization trends is boosting demand for high-end and sports mufflers, particularly in North America and Europe. Fifth, advancements in materials science and manufacturing techniques-such as robotic welding, hydroforming, and additive manufacturing-are making mufflers more durable, efficient, and cost-effective. Lastly, ongoing maintenance and replacement cycles in the global vehicle parc (the active vehicle population on roads) are generating steady aftermarket demand, especially in regions with stringent vehicle inspection regimes or challenging road and climate conditions.
